Quran Recitation Etiquette
A Muslim should use both internal and external manners and etiquette when reciting the holy Quran.
- While exterior manners impact our actions and every bodily part, internal manners refer to the affairs of the heart.
- The minimal rules of etiquette we should adhere to when reciting the Quran.
- ought to be in an ablution condition.
- Sitting properly in a peaceful area, the cleanliness of the body, attire, and location.
- Keep your head covered.
- Turn to face the Qibla.
- looking for safety from Satan.
- Being modest when reciting the Quran
- Knowing where words come from
- When reciting the Quran, pay close attention.
How Can a Non-Arabic Speaker Read the Quran Understandably?
For non-Arabic speakers, reading the Quran with comprehension is a feasible aim that doesn’t require years of full-time study before anything becomes relevant. The Quran recitation course will help you to:
-
Begin by learning high-frequency words from the Quran
Words that appear 100 times or more make up over 70% of the Quran. A reader can gain meaningful access to much of the book by mastering the 300 most common terms in the Quran.

Concurrently Integrate Meaning and Tajweed Research
Many students approach comprehension and Tajweed as distinct objectives to be pursued one after the other. According to our educators, mastering them concurrently yields superior outcomes.
When a pupil comprehends what they are repeating, correct recitation takes on greater significance, and comprehension is strengthened when careful, focused recitation is combined with it.

Recite Tafsir every day with a companion.
Understanding is gradually increased over months by reading even one page of a trustworthy English-language Tafsir, such as Tafsir Ibn Kathir (translated) or Tafsir As-Sa’di, in addition to reciting the Quran every day.
